Abstract

resumo “conjunto de válvula de ventilação e método para montar um conjunto de válvula de ventilação de tanque de combustível” um conjunto de válvula de ventilação (10, 110, 210, 310) inclui um primeiro componente de alojamento (20, 120, 220, 320), um segundo componente de alojamento (22, 122, 222, 322), e um terceiro componente de alojamento (24, 124, 224, 324), bem como uma primeira válvula (12, 112, 212, 312) e uma segunda válvula (14, 114, 214, 314). os primeiro, segundo, e terceiro componentes de alojamento são configurados para serem montados uns aos outros ao longo de um eixo geométrico direcional (e) com o segundo componente de alojamento, a primeira válvula e a segunda válvula entre os primeiro e terceiro componentes de alojamento, e com a segunda válvula deslocada lateralmente a partir da primeira válvula. os primeiro, segundo, e terceiro componentes de alojamento montados definem uma trajetória de fluxo de vapor não linear (a, b, c) que redireciona o vapor a partir da primeira válvula para a segunda válvula, reduzindo assim uma altura total do conjunto de válvula de ventilação. 1/1
